Overview

A NICU Specialist provides intensive medical care to critically ill or premature newborns in Neonatal Intensive Care Units. These professionals are trained to monitor life-support systems, administer medications, and offer support to families during stressful times. They work closely with neonatologists and pediatricians to ensure the best outcomes for newborns. Their role is highly specialized, requiring emotional resilience and advanced clinical skills. They play a vital part in neonatal survival and recovery.

Job Description
  1. Monitor and care for premature or critically ill newborns.
  2. Operate and manage neonatal life-support equipment.
  3. Administer medications and IV nutrition accurately.
  4. Record vital signs and respond promptly to emergencies.
  5. Provide emotional support and guidance to families.
  6. Collaborate with doctors and NICU teams for treatment planning.
  7. Ensure sterile and safe handling of infants and their surroundings.
